How they compare
Gambia currently reports 73.96 million against 64.11 million in Barbados, a difference of 9.85 million.
That makes Gambia's figure about 1.2 times Barbados's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 75 shared years of data; in 1950 it was Barbados ahead.
Barbados ranks 170th and Gambia ranks 169th of 194 countries.
Gambia has averaged higher in every one of the 8 decades both report.
